Rework problem 31 from section 3.4 of your text, involving the selection of a flight between New York and Los Angeles. Assume that there are three airlines from which to choose, each with a number of flights per day, and an on-time percentage shown below. (Assume that delays occur randomly.) A traveler selects a flight at random, and it arrives on time.Solution
As per the table given, we will multiply the number of flights with on time percentage to use to calculate the probability to flew by each flight.
(1) Probability that the traveller flew on North-South Air = 3/3+2.4+4.9 = 3/10.3 = 0.2913
(2) Probability that the traveller flew on East-West Air = 2.4/10.3 = 0.233
(3) Probability that the traveller flew on Best Air = 4.9/10.3 = 0.4757
| Airline | Num. of Flights | On time percentage | Multiply |
| North-South Air | 5 | 60 | 3 |
| East-Weat Air | 3 | 80 | 2.4 |
| Best Air | 7 | 70 | 4.9 |
